Black Forest dessert

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• n. B. Cake (chocolate cake leftovers), crushed
  • 1 jar cherry(s)
  • starch flour
  • 250 g low-fat curd cheese
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 1 packet of vanilla sugar
  • 200 ml cream
  • ½ lemon(s), the juice
  • Chocolate shavings
  • Whipped cream, from a spray can or whipped yourself
  • Cherry brandy for the cake base, optional

Instructions

Working time approx. 35 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 5 minutes; Total time approx. 40 minutes

For the cream, mix together the quark, sugar, vanilla sugar, cream, and lemon juice. Drain the cherries. Collect the juice, bring it to a boil in a saucepan, and stir in a little cornstarch until the juice begins to thicken. Then add the cherries to the pan and heat briefly. If you like, you can also bake the chocolate cake yourself. It can be a regular sponge cake or a chocolate sponge. For flavor, you can also soak the base with kirsch. Now layer everything in a glass: cream, cake, cherries, cream, cake, etc. Finally, add the whipped cream and chocolate shavings for decoration.
